随着区块链技术的不断发展,虚拟货币的流行程度与日俱增。无论是投资者、开发者还是普通用户,大家对于虚拟币的关注从未停止。虽然虚拟币的市场在波动,但加密货币背后的技术和理念始终引人关注。在这一篇文章中,我们将详细介绍虚拟币的研发流程,并解答一些相关问题,让你全面了解这一领域。
虚拟币,也称为加密货币,是一种利用密码学技术进行保护的数字资产。虚拟币的研发流程涉及多个环节,包括构思、设计、开发、测试和上线。每一个环节都有其独特的重要性和挑战。
一般来说,虚拟币研发的目标可以是解决一个特定问题、改进现有的货币体系、或者是提供一种新的交易方式。研发团队需要考虑市场需求、技术可行性及安全性等一系列因素,确保最终产品能够在市场上获得成功。
任何一个项目的成功都离不开清晰的概念和需求分析。虚拟币的研发通常从一份市场调研开始,开发者需要深入了解当前市场上已存在的币种、竞争对手的情况,以及潜在的用户需求。
这一步骤还包括识别目标受众,明确虚拟币所要解决的问题。例如,如果开发一款用于跨境支付的虚拟币,团队需要调查现有支付系统的局限性,以及用户在使用过程中的痛点和需求。
有了明确的需求之后,接下来必须进行技术设计。这一阶段会涉及选择区块链技术栈、智能合约的设计、以及安全性措施的构建。开发者通常会在这一阶段决定币种的共识机制,比如是采用工作量证明(PoW)、权益证明(PoS)还是其他机制。
此外,技术设计还包括币的总量、算力分配、以及交易确认的时间等参数的设定。优秀的设计不仅能保证系统的高效运作,更能在系统进行错误处理、故障恢复和防止攻击时提供必要的保障。
在完成了技术设计后,开发团队会进入编码阶段。开发者会根据先前的设计文档进行程序编写,搭建区块链、钱包和用户界面等必要的功能模块。这一过程中,团队需要定期进行代码审查,通过不断迭代完善代码质量,并确保其功能的准确性。
开发过程中还包括与用户进行有效的沟通,获取反馈。这一阶段可以使用敏捷开发的方法,以便在短时间内完成多个迭代,使项目能更快速地适应市场需求。
开发完成后,团队需要进行全面的测试,以确保系统的稳定性和安全性。测试通常包括功能测试、安全测试、压力测试等,这些都是确保虚拟币在上线前不发生重大故障的保障措施。
由于虚拟币涉及资金的转移,任何一个小的错误都可能导致用户的重大损失。因此,团队需要招聘专业的测试人员,进行全面而系统的测试,以降低上线后的风险。
经过严格的测试后,虚拟币终于可以进入发布阶段。发布通常伴随着市场推广和宣传活动。团队需要制定合理的营销策略,与社区、交易所等建立良好的关系,提高虚拟币的知名度。
除了传统的市场推广,虚拟币项目还常常会进行ICO(首次代币发行)或IEO(首次交易所发行),以筹集资金和扩大用户群体。这一过程也需要团队的策略规划,确保项目的长远发展。
发布并不是结束,虚拟币的运营和维护才是长期的任务。团队需要持续监测市场表现,保持与用户互动,快速解决可能出现的问题,定期进行版本更新。此时,反馈机制和用户支持将显得尤为重要,帮助团队及时改进产品。
同时,团队还需关注安全问题,定期强化系统的安全性开发,分析潜在的安全隐患,以保障用户资产的安全。
区块链技术的分布式和去中心化特性使得虚拟币具备了极高的安全性和透明度。其中,分布式账本的机制是其核心优势。传统金融系统需要依赖第三方机构来处理交易,而区块链能通过技术手段去除这一中介。
使用区块链可以有效防止篡改和伪造数据,这对于虚拟币的信任度至关重要。每一笔交易都被加密存储在多个节点中,想要进行攻击需同时控制超过51%的网络节点,这在经济上是极不划算的。
此外,区块链技术的透明性让所有的交易记录都可被公众验证,对于用户来说,这意味着更高的安全感和信任度。数据持久性和不易修改的特性,也是虚拟币作为价值存储的关键。
在评估一个新虚拟币的投资价值时,投资者通常会关注多个因素。首先是团队背景,包括开发者的技术能力、项目经历以及与其他圈子的联系。一个有实力的团队可以大大提升项目的成功率。
其次,要分析虚拟币的技术白皮书,了解其技术架构、功能设计和市场定位。一个好的白皮书应该明确阐释项目的价值、愿景及解决方案。
另外,市场需求也是评估的重要因素。了解目标用户群体的规模及需求,确保资金的投入能够带来有效的回报。最后,分析市场趋势和同行竞争情况,关注市场上已有替代品的表现,谨慎做出投资决策。
随着虚拟币的兴起,各国对于加密货币的法律监管政策持续变化。不同国家的法规差异可能会对虚拟币的开发和运营产生重大影响。例如,一些国家对ICO实施严格的合规要求,而有些国家则明令禁止相关行为。
法律管控的模糊性可能使得开发者和投资者面临合规风险,甚至可能导致法律惩罚。因此,研发团队在启动项目时应主动了解涉及的法律法规,并聘请法律顾问进行风险评估。
同时,随着不断变化的区块链生态,开发团队需要保持灵活和适应性,及时调整策略以应对可能出现的法律挑战。这是保证项目能持续运营下去的关键因素之一。
共识机制在虚拟币的开发中扮演了至关重要的角色,不同的机制直接影响网络的安全性、效率和去中心化程度。在选择共识机制时,开发团队需要考虑多个因素。
首先,团队需要了解项目的目标和需求。例如,如果目标是快速处理交易,DPoS(委托权益证明)可能是合适的选择;如果更重视安全性和去中心化,PoW(工作量证明)可能更有效。
其次,还应考虑资源的消耗。比如,PoW机制对计算资源有较高要求,导致普遍的能耗问题。而PoS则通过持币参与共识决策,能有效减少能源消耗。这种选择影响着项目的可持续发展。
最后,团队需关注社区的参与度和活跃度,要保证用户的权益参与其中,这对于共识机制的长久成功是至关重要的。
随着技术的不断进步,未来虚拟币的发展趋势可概括为以下几个方面。首先,安全性将继续成为重点。随着市场的成熟,黑客攻击和安全威胁层出不穷,开发者需要不断采取措施提高虚拟币的安全性。
其次,监管政策将逐渐完善,形成更加透明的市场环境。各国针对加密货币的法律法规将更加健全,为良性的发展提供保障。同时,合规的虚拟币项目将受到更多投资者的信赖和青睐。
此外,跨链技术和互操作性问题将逐渐被关注,未来区块链之间的互联互通将成为趋势。这意味着不同虚拟币之间的交易将更加便利,用户体验更佳。
最后,随着去中心化金融(DeFi)和数字资产的快速发展,虚拟币作为数字经济的一部分,其应用场景将不断丰富,未来有望实现更广泛的应用。
综上所述,虚拟币研发流程涉及多个阶段,从概念到上线需要时间的积累和技术的沉淀。理解这一过程不仅有助于开发者的实践,也为投资者提供了决策的依据。希望本文能为读者在虚拟币探索的道路上提供一定的指引。